Taiwan’s International Orchid Show opened on Friday in Tainan. It’s the 20th anniversary of the annual show of Taiwan’s most famous flowers. Taiwan’s orchid show has become one of the top three orchid shows in the world, alongside the World Orchid Conference and Tokyo’s orchid expo. Taiwan will even host the World Orchid Conference in 2024.
Vice President Lai Ching-te (賴清德) said that Taiwan’s orchids have become famous throughout the world. Just as tulips have become a great industry for Holland, Taiwan’s orchids have also created great value for Taiwan and its farmers.
This year’s expo features flags of Ukraine and Turkey made with orchids to show Taiwan’s support for the people of Ukraine and Turkey. The expo also hosts contests, flower design classes, lectures, forums and DIY events.
The 2023 exhibit will be held from March 3 to March 19 in Tainan at the Taiwan Orchid Plantation.
